# 设置按商品自动分配

调试诊断

接口应在服务器端调用,不可在前端(小程序、网页、APP等)直接调用,具体可参考接口调用指南

接口英文名:set_product_distribution

本接口用于设置按商品ID自动分配给指定供货商,对新增订单生效。设置生效前产生的存量订单维持原有分配方式。

# 1. 调用方式

# HTTPS 调用

POST https://api.weixin.qq.com/channels/ec/supplier/relation/set_product_distribute?access_token=ACCESS_TOKEN

# 云调用

  • 本接口不支持云调用。

# 第三方调用

# 2. 请求参数

# 查询参数 Query String Parameters

参数名类型必填示例说明
access_tokenstringACCESS_TOKEN接口调用凭证,可使用 access_token(微信小店商家)、authorizer_access_token(服务商代调用)

# 请求体 Request Payload

参数名类型必填说明
listobjarray设置列表

# Body.list(Array) Object Payload

设置列表

参数名类型必填说明
supplier_appidstring商品id
product_idnumber该商品是否设置自动分配
is_distributeboolean该商品自动分配给该供货商,当且仅当is_distribute = true时填写

# 3. 返回参数

# 返回体 Response Payload

参数名类型说明
errcodenumber错误码
errmsgstring错误描述

# 4. 注意事项

list 的数量不超过 200。

# 5. 代码示例

请求示例

{
    "list": {
        "supplier_appid": "",
        "product_id": 0,
        "is_distribute": false
    }
}

返回示例

{
    "errcode": 0,
    "errmsg": ""
}

# 6. 错误码

此接口没有特殊错误码,可参考 通用错误码;调用接口遇到报错,可使用官方提供的 API 诊断工具 辅助定位和分析问题。

# 7. 适用范围

本接口支持「微信小店」账号类型调用。其他账号类型如无特殊说明,均不可调用。